## Deployment

The Willowbrook Clinic reminder job (codename Nudgework) runs as a scheduled container task. It reads the day's appointment roster at 05:00 local, batches reminders by preferred channel, and writes delivery receipts back to the roster store. Deploys are cut from the release branch only; hotfixes require sign-off from the on-call lead. Rollback is a simple re-tag since the job is stateless between runs. Before promoting a build, confirm it was validated against the configuration values below.

settings of bawif-fawif:
ralix:
  log_level: warn
  metrics_host: metrics.ralix.tolvaqsys.internal
  pool_size: 32

Break-Glass Access: Coldvault Archival

Archiving cold storage buckets at Merrowbase requires elevated access that is normally sealed. Only use this procedure when the Tindral scheduler has failed and data retention deadlines are at risk. Verify the incident number with your shift lead, document your actions in the access log, and then authenticate with the break-glass passphrase shown below.

unlock words, fadug-tageg: zorix-wenwyn-quenmir

Subject: Retirement of the Quillstone Line

To the heads of department: after careful review, the executive team has approved retiring the Quillstone product line. Support continues for eighteen months, with migration paths to the Elmsworth platform documented. Departmental transition owners should be named by Friday. The confidential summary of our forward plans follows below.

board note of tadup-fahag: The board signed off on a budget of $42.0 million for Project Fenath.

For plugin authors integrating with Fenwick Relay: deliveries that return a non-2xx status are retried with exponential backoff plus jitter, capped at six attempts over roughly 40 minutes. A 410 response permanently disables the endpoint, so document that clearly for your users. Duplicate deliveries are possible after timeouts — always dedupe on the event ID header. Signature verification stays mandatory on every attempt, including retries. The backoff schedule, attempt cap, and timeout windows are set by the values below.

deployment values, fahap-hahaf:
[casdor]
port = 9200
region = south-2
host = casdor.qirvanworks.corp
timeout_ms = 3000
retries = 4